fix bug in rename public folders

This commit is contained in:
dev_amdtel 2015-04-05 13:43:59 +04:00
parent 6489ebb2a4
commit b321ba04ea

View file

@ -4995,12 +4995,18 @@ namespace WebsitePanel.Providers.HostedSolution
//general settings
Command cmd = new Command("Set-MailPublicFolder");
cmd.Parameters.Add("Identity", folder);
if (!folderName.Equals(newFolderName, StringComparison.OrdinalIgnoreCase))
{
cmd.Parameters.Add("Name", newFolderName);
}
cmd.Parameters.Add("HiddenFromAddressListsEnabled", hideFromAddressBook);
ExecuteShellCommand(runSpace, cmd);
// rename
if (!folderName.Equals(newFolderName, StringComparison.OrdinalIgnoreCase))
{
cmd = new Command("Set-PublicFolder");
cmd.Parameters.Add("Identity", folder);
cmd.Parameters.Add("Name", newFolderName);
ExecuteShellCommand(runSpace, cmd);
}
}
finally
{